Elite Interceptor // Rejoinder, Creature — human wizard , designed by Lindsey Look & Lindsey Look first released in Apr, 2026 in the set Secrets of Strixhaven. It see play in 1 formats: Pauper.
Elite Interceptor // Rejoinder looks best suited for a tempo or blink-based Azorius (white-blue) deck that values flexibility, incremental card draw, and battlefield control, especially one that can repeatedly reset or re‑“prepare” creatures to reuse the spell-copy effect. The tap/untap ability supports tempo strategies (tapping blockers or untapping your own attacker/mana creature), while drawing a card keeps it from costing you card advantage, making it attractive in midrange-control shells that want cheap interaction stapled to a body. However, compared to highly efficient staples like Reflector Mage (which provides stronger tempo disruption), Skyclave Apparition (clean removal), or even cantrip creatures like Spirited Companion (guaranteed card draw at low cost), this card seems more flexible than powerful; its impact depends heavily on how easy “prepared” is to enable repeatedly.
